Overview Voglimin-M 0.3 Tablet SR
Diabexe-M 0.3 Extended-Release Tablet is an antidiabetic medication, a combination formulation for adult patients with type 2 diabetes. It helps manage blood glucose levels. Diabexe-M 0.3 ER should be administered with meals, consistently at the same time daily for optimal efficacy. Dosage is determined by your physician and may be adjusted based on your glycemic control. Continuous use is crucial; discontinuation without medical consultation can lead to elevated blood sugar, increasing the risk of complications such as nephropathy, retinopathy, neuropathy, and limb loss. This medication complements a comprehensive diabetes management plan, incorporating diet, exercise, and weight management as recommended by your doctor. Lifestyle modifications are key to diabetes control. Potential side effects include gastrointestinal upset (nausea, altered taste, decreased appetite, gas, abdominal pain, diarrhea) and skin rash; these are usually transient. Consult your physician if side effects persist or are concerning; management strategies may be available. This medication is contraindicated in type 1 diabetes, diabetic ketoacidosis, and severe hepatic or renal impairment. Prior heart disease should be disclosed to your doctor before commencing treatment. Pregnant or lactating individuals should seek medical advice before use. Regular blood glucose monitoring, along with potential blood tests to assess blood cell counts and liver function, will be necessary.

S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Combining Voglimin-M 0.3 Tablet SR and alcohol is not advised due to safety concerns.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Voglimin-M 0.3 Tablet SR during pregnancy might pose risks.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to the unborn child. A physician will assess the potential advantages against any possible dangers pr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The extended-release Voglimin-M 0.3mg tablet is likely not safe for use while breastfeeding. Available human data indicates potential transfer to bre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.
DrivingSAFE
Driving ability is typically unaffected by Voglimin-M 0.3 Tablet SR. Nevertheless, patients using this medication concurrently with other diabetes treatments like sulfonylureas, insulin, or repaglinide should be aware of the potential for low blood sugar (hypoglycemia).
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should use Voglimin-M 0.3 mg sustained-release t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Severe kidney disease contraindicates Voglimin-M 0.3 mg sustained-release tablet use. Physician consultation is recommended. Regular kidney function monitoring is advised during treatment.
LiverC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Insufficient data exists regarding Voglimin-M 0.3 Tablet SR use in individuals with hepatic impairment. Physician consultation is advised.
What if you forget to take Voglimin-M 0.3 Tablet SR :
Should you forget to take a Voglimin-M 0.3 Tablet SR, administer it immediately upon remembrance.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ing pattern. Avoid taking a double dose.
